Clean, potable water wherever you are

MANILA, Philippines - Water is such a precious necessity for mankind, but in some areas of the world, drinking water can be very hard to find.  Even in a water-rich country like the Philippines, far-flung areas that are even near water bodies can still be deprived of clean drinking water that every human needs.  Also, disasters including earthquakes, hurricanes, tornadoes, and floods often result in limited or compromised access to water systems.

Today, a life-changing invention made in Europe is now available in the Philippines.  The award-winning LifeStraw portable water filter can remove bacteria and parasites even from unclean water sources, and is ideal for outdoor activities, travel, emergency preparedness, and survival.

LifeStraw is an elegantly simple but technologically advanced innovation. The filtering tube measures about nine inches long and one inch in diameter, and weighs less than two ounces. It removes virtually all bacteria (99.9999 percent) and protozoa parasites (99.9 percent) that can contaminate water, and it reduces turbidity (muddiness) by filtering out particulate matter.  Rigorous laboratory testing of LifeStraw conducted by the University of Arizona found that LifeStraw performance exceeded US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) water filtration requirements for bacteria and parasites, including Escherichia coli, Cryptosporidium, Giardia lamblia, Salmonella, and other waterborne pathogens.

Also, LifeStraw has been designed to last. The filter is made of durable plastic, is chemical-free (and BPA-free), and does not require electrical power, batteries or replacement parts; it is powered by user-generated suction. When used properly, each LifeStraw will filter at least 700 liters (185 gallons) of water.

Since it is portable, it takes up little space in a camper’s backpack or a traveler’s luggage.  It is also the perfect first-aid tool for disaster preparedness, especially during times of typhoons and rains, when safe potable water can be drawn even from unlikely safe water sources.

Another innovative product of LifeStraw is the LifeStraw Family, a point-of-use microbial water treatment system intended for routine use in low-income settings.  It can filter up to 18,000 liters of water, enough to supply a family of five with microbiologically clean drinking water for three years.  It also ensures high flow rate and high volume of purified water.
